介绍
VS Code是一款非常流行的编码工具,具有丰富的功能和插件。在Node.js开发过程中,调试是必不可少的环节。掌握VS Code的调试功能可以使得我们更快速地排查问题,提升开发效率。本文将详细介绍如何在VS Code中调试Node.js程序。
安装调试插件
在VS Code中,调试功能主要由调试插件提供。在开始调试之前,我们需要在VS Code扩展市场中安装Node.js调试插件。安装方法如下:
步骤一:打开扩展面板
可通过按下快捷键Ctrl+Shift+X(Windows)或Shift+Command+X(Mac)来打开扩展面板。也可以通过菜单栏View -> Extensions打开。
步骤二:搜索插件
在搜索框中输入node,会列出所有与Node.js相关的扩展和插件。
步骤三:选择插件
选择Node.js插件,点击安装按钮安装。
配置调试设置
调试工具需要通过配置文件来指定运行的程序和调试参数,以及断点等信息。在使用调试工具之前,需要对调试设置进行一些配置。具体方法如下:
步骤一:打开调试面板
可通过按下快捷键Ctrl+Shift+D(Windows)或Shift+Command+D(Mac)来打开调试面板。也可以通过菜单栏View -> Debug打开。
步骤二:添加配置
点击"create a launch.json file"按钮,VS Code将会自动创建一个默认的配置文件launch.json并打开它。
{
"version": "0.2.0",
"configurations": [
{
"type": "node",
"request": "launch",
"name": "Launch program",
"program": "${workspaceFolder}/index.js"
}
]
}
这里配置了一个名称为Launch program的运行任务,其程序入口为index.js文件。program的路径可以根据实际情况进行调整。
使用调试器
在完成配置后,我们可以运行程序并进行调试了。具体步骤如下:
步骤一:添加断点
在程序中添加断点,用于在运行过程中暂停程序。断点的添加可以采用快捷键F9或在编辑器最左侧单击行号添加。
步骤二:启动调试器
点击调试面板中的"Start Debugging"按钮,或使用快捷键F5,即可启动调试器。
步骤三:调试过程中查看变量
在调试过程中,我们可以使用VS Code提供的"Debug Console"来查看程序中的变量。
步骤四:结束调试
在调试过程中,在调试面板中点击"Stop"按钮,或使用快捷键Shift+F5,即可结束调试。
总结
在本文中,我们学习了如何在VS Code中配置和使用调试器。掌握调试工具和技巧,能够提升开发效率,加快排查问题的速度。在实际开发中,也可以通过扩展插件和配置文件,对调试工具进行进一步的扩展和优化。